Across the eight cakes, WTF cycles through one of the most comprehensive effect lists available in any single consumer compound firework in the UK market:
Brocades — dense, fine cascading silver-gold trails that fill the sky with shimmering light and exceptional hang time, overlapping continuously in WTF's rapid-fire volleys to create an almost unbroken golden canopy.
Golden Willows — enormous drooping trails of warm golden stars that hang and drift before fading, the iconic willow effect producing the most visually graceful moments in WTF's relentless sequence.
Strobing Dahlias — full-sphere dahlia bursts of vivid coloured stars that flash rhythmically with strobe pulses, combining the bold visual impact of the dahlia shape with the dynamic, pulsing energy of strobe effects in multiple colours throughout the eight cakes.
Chrysanthemum Crackles — multi-trailing crackle bursts where stars fan outward in graceful arcs before erupting into sharp, snapping crackle effects at the tips, adding sharp audio texture and visual complexity to WTF's continuous canopy.
Coloured Peonies — full, round bursts of vivid coloured stars that spread in rich, symmetrical spheres across the sky in multiple colours, providing the most vivid and saturated colour moments across WTF's eight-cake sequence.
Glittering Stars — dense, glittering star bursts that shimmer and sparkle across the full sky, adding a fine, textured layer of light between the larger and more dramatic main effects.
Palm Bursts — radial explosions where thick comet tails sweep outward in multiple directions from a central detonation, creating the distinctive palm tree silhouette at height that is one of the most crowd-pleasing effects in consumer pyrotechnics.

WTF requires a minimum safety distance of 15 metres between the firing position and all spectators, structures, vehicles, and boundaries. While this is lower than F3 products with a 25-metre requirement, the 5 out of 5 noise level, 30-metre height, and 3,992g powder weight mean exceeding this distance wherever possible is strongly recommended. A practical recommended distance of 25 metres will significantly improve the viewing experience and safety margin.
WTF is constructed as eight pre-fused cakes mounted on a board — ensure the board is placed on firm, flat, level ground before ignition. Never place on uneven, soft, or sloped surfaces. The board format means staking is not required in the same way as a single boxed compound, but the firing surface must be completely stable and level before firing.
WTF is classified as Hazard Class 1.3G, Category F3 — a professional-grade pyrotechnic. Despite its F3 category, WTF's 15-metre minimum safety distance makes it more accessible than many F3 compounds.
